The Casper-Natrona County Health Department has published its weekly report detailing compliance checks for local food service establishments. The inspections, conducted from February 13th through February 19th, are routine assessments of facilities including restaurants, grocery stores, convenience stores, and mobile food units to ensure they meet state and local health codes.
The primary goal of these regular visits is to verify that businesses are maintaining conditions that prevent foodborne illness and protect public health. Inspectors evaluate critical areas such as food temperature controls, proper handwashing, sanitation of equipment and surfaces, and overall facility maintenance. Establishments found to be in violation are required to correct issues promptly, often during the inspection itself for minor infractions.
While the vast majority of local businesses maintain satisfactory standards, the inspection process is a vital tool for continuous improvement and consumer awareness. The health department emphasizes that these reports reflect a snapshot in time and that conditions are subject to change. Residents are encouraged to view the detailed findings, which are a matter of public record, to make informed choices about where they dine and shop for food. The department reiterates its commitment to working collaboratively with all food service operators to uphold the highest possible safety standards for the community.
